A new calculator, the DCDAM score, utilizes diameter, cirrhosis, differentiation, AFP, and MVI grade to accurately predict early recurrence of HCC with MVI. Patients in the high-risk group (DCDAM score > 169) experience poor RFS and OS and respond well to postoperative adjuvant TACE.

This systematic review and meta-analysis found that neoadjuvant therapy significantly reduces the risk of postoperative pancreatic fistula (POPF) after pancreatoduodenectomy, likely due to induced pancreatic fibrosis. It suggests potential for improved surgical outcomes but emphasizes the need for individualized treatment based on predicted tumor response.

With the aim to enhance quality control and standardize TACE procedures, the concept of "precision TACE" is introduced by ISMIO, emphasizing standardized angiography, superselective catheterization and embolization, appropriate selection of embolic agents, determination of optimal embolization endpoints, and evaluation for efficacy immediately post-TACE.
